There's NO registering for ANYTHING when it comes to 'selling' on ANY 3rd Party venue.
You simply 'report' the amount that is on the 1099 that you get end of year (as the IRS get's the same copy); then 'write off' expenses as needed to get down to a REAL taxable amount.
